BOB GATEWAY BRIDGED USDC (BOB NETWORK) (USDC.E) FAQ
What is the difference between native USDC and usdc.e on the BOB Network?
Native USDC is issued directly by Circle and is redeemable 1:1 for U.S. dollars. In contrast, usdc.e is a bridged or "wrapped" version. When USDC is moved from Ethereum to the BOB Network via the official BOB Gateway, the native token is locked in a smart contract on Ethereum, and an equivalent amount of usdc.e is minted on the BOB Layer-2. The ".e" suffix indicates its origin from the Ethereum network.
Is usdc.e safe for users within the BOB ecosystem?
While usdc.e aims to maintain a 1:1 value with the US dollar, it involves bridge risk. This means the value of usdc.e depends on the security of the Ethereum smart contract where the native USDC is locked. If that contract were compromised, the bridged asset could lose value. However, it is the standard stablecoin used for DeFi activities on the BOB Network and is considered the primary representation of USDC within that specific ecosystem.
How do I bridge USDC to the BOB Network?
To bridge USDC, users typically use the official BOB Gateway. The process involves visiting the bridge platform, connecting a compatible Web3 wallet, and selecting USDC as the source asset with BOB as the destination. Once the transaction is confirmed on the Ethereum network, the corresponding amount of usdc.e will be minted and appear in your wallet on the BOB Network.

Can usdc.e be redeemed directly for physical US dollars?
No, usdc.e cannot be sent directly to a centralized exchange to be cashed out for USD. To off-ramp, you must first bridge the assets back from the BOB Network to Ethereum. This process converts the usdc.e back into native USDC. Once the native USDC is back on the Ethereum mainnet, it can then be sent to an exchange like LBank for conversion into fiat currency.
Where is usdc.e used on the BOB Network and how are gas fees paid?
As the primary stablecoin on the BOB Network, usdc.e is used for trading on decentralized exchanges, providing liquidity, and acting as collateral in lending and borrowing protocols. It is essential to note that while you use usdc.e for transactions, gas fees on the BOB Network are typically paid in ETH, which serves as the native gas token for this Layer-2 solution.
